The US will not defend Israel at UN human rights forum

 The United States will not take the floor at the main U.N. human rights forum on Monday during the annual debate on violations committed in the Palestinian territories. Washington has unfailingly defended Israel in the regular, disproportionate assaults on its human rights record, but is abstaining this time to signal the Obama administration’s "reassessment" of relations with Israel.

Senator John McCain commented Sunday that the president should "get over his temper tantrum” against prime minister Netanyahu and start working with “our Israeli friends" to try and stem "this tide of ISIS and Iranian movement which is threatening the very fabric of the region…Bibi's rhetoric [on a Palestinian state] during an election campaign pales in comparison as to the direct threat to the United States of America concerning ISIS."
